I haven't used Bitbucket for nearly a year now and it "seems" to have lost my account. It looks like Atlassian has taken control of Bitbucket now(?). Either way, the odd thing is that I can use my Bitbucket credentials to login to Atlassian, but Bitbucket is saying my account doesn't exist and therefore I can't get access to my repo (assuming it still exists).

What happened?

Bitbucket was always owned by Atlassian but recently they migrated all the accounts to use Atlassian id. That might be the case here.
